Our mission:

Enlighten to Make a Difference was created by Selena Garcia, and Gregoria Uroza. Their focus is to help as many preschools and elementary schools as possible, to close the gap in education. They became passionate about finding ways to promote effective communication among schools and students when they physically saw students feeling isolated. These types of students could not find a comfortable connection with their school. By creating the enlighten library and bench they are promoting active literacy during recess time and eliminating barriers within the environment, they are associated with. They believe that adding a different activity during recess such as the access to read a book will be a benefit to students such as a fun activity and an educational tool to improve their literacy skills. The benches will also help strengthen relationships between students and their school staff. They want the students to feel comfortable sharing the good and bad times of their days.

Project Descriptions:


Enlighten Library

(Promoting literacy during recess time):

"If you don't feel like playing today, play with your mind"

-Enlighten to make a difference.

The goal of this project is to connect with the students who at times do not want to run around but would rather sit down and play with their minds by reading books. On September 8’18, National day of Service- GatorServe volunteers will get in groups of two to build house-shape bookshelves. With these bookshelves, we will help provide access to books during recess time for preschool and elementary school students. We will not only be building the shelves but we will come together to decorate them with paint and will be organizing books to be delivered along with the shelves.

Enlighten Bench

(Eliminate Barriers):

"The only way to make a friend is to be one"

-Ralph Waldo Emerson

The goal of this project is to create a simple idea to eliminate barriers between students, peers, teachers and staff. On September 8, 2018 National day of Service- GatorServe volunteers will get in groups of 3-4 to build benches for preschool and elementary school students. With this bench, we want to help improve a student's day at school by allowing them easy access to a spot where they can feel comfortable sharing. Together we will also be painting these benches with creative designs and positive quotes.
